School Uniform Embroidery Digitizing: The Basics

School uniform embroidery digitizing is the process of converting school artwork, whether a crest, coat of arms, name text, or institutional logo, into a machine-readable stitch file. This file tells your embroidery machine exactly where to stitch, what stitch type to use, how dense to make each fill area, and in what sequence to lay down each color.

The reason digitizing is so critical for school uniforms specifically is the combination of design complexity and production volume. School crests often include fine detail, thin script lettering, small heraldic elements, and multiple colors all packed into a relatively small area, typically 3 to 4 inches on a blazer chest or 2 to 2.5 inches on a shirt pocket. Getting all of that to stitch cleanly requires expert judgment that auto-digitizing software simply can't replicate.

Production volume compounds the stakes. A school uniform supplier might run hundreds or thousands of identical crests across a term. If the digitizing file has a problem, that problem appears on every single piece. The cost of a bad file isn't just one bad uniform. It's the rework time, the wasted thread, and potentially the reputational damage with the school client.

Embroidery Digitizing Services for School Crests

Embroidery digitizing services for school crests need to handle a very specific set of design challenges that general digitizing services often underestimate. A school crest is almost always a complex, multi-element design that was originally created for print, not embroidery. Converting it properly requires careful judgment about what can be faithfully reproduced in thread and what needs to be adapted.

Most school crests include a combination of detailed imagery, such as shields, animals, books, torches, or other heraldic elements, paired with motto text, often in small font sizes, and sometimes a banner or scroll element wrapping around the main design. On paper or screen, these elements look clean and precise. In embroidery, thin lines under 1mm, very small text, and fine gradient areas all become problems without expert handling.

A skilled digitizer working on school crest embroidery makes judgment calls at every step. They simplify design elements that are too fine to stitch clearly at the required size. They choose between satin stitches and fill stitches based on element width and shape. They set underlay patterns that stabilize different fabric zones before top stitches come down. They plan the color sequence to minimize jumps and ensure each element registers cleanly against adjacent colors.

Digitizing for Embroidery on School Blazers

Digitizing for embroidery on school blazers involves unique challenges that don't come up with most other garment types. Blazers are typically made from heavyweight wool, poly-wool blends, or structured woven fabrics that behave very differently from the cotton and polyester used in casual embroidered clothing.

Heavyweight structured fabrics push back against needle penetration in ways that lighter materials don't. This affects stitch density, underlay design, and even needle size recommendations. If a digitizer sets density too high for a heavy wool blazer, the fabric bunches and distorts around the design. Too low, and the fabric shows through the fill areas and the design looks thin and faded.

The embroidery stabilizer choice is critical here. Most school blazer crest work uses a cut-away stabilizer backing because the designs are dense and durable, and the stabilizer needs to hold up across years of washing. The digitizer needs to account for how the stabilizer interacts with the fabric's natural drape and structure.

Placement matters too. The standard crest position on a school blazer is the left chest, usually centered over the breast pocket. The exact placement coordinates need to be consistent across every blazer in a batch, which means your digitizing file should include placement marks or centerline indicators. Custom Embroidery Digitizing for School Names

Custom embroidery digitizing for school names, whether stitching the school's name across a collar, a student's name on a sports kit, or a house name on a PE top, requires a clean approach to text digitizing that a lot of services get wrong.

Text in embroidery is genuinely harder than it looks. Fonts that work beautifully in print often have thin strokes, tight spacing, or sharp serifs that don't translate well into thread. Small embroidered text, anything under 0.25 inches in height, risks becoming an unreadable blob of thread unless the digitizer specifically adapts the letterforms for stitching.

For student name personalization on school uniforms, digitizing is typically handled as a template where the name field uses an embroidery-safe font that's been pre-digitized and tested. Schools and suppliers then simply input different names using the same approved font and size. This is much more efficient than re-digitizing each name individually and ensures every student's name looks identical in style.

Monogram embroidery is a related application. Some schools use individual student monograms on sports uniforms or house team kits. Monogram digitizing follows the same principles as name digitizing but often uses decorative letter styles that need careful handling to stitch cleanly.

Machine Embroidery Digitizing for School Logos

Machine embroidery digitizing for school logos brings together all the challenges of crest work and name work in a single file. School logos that have evolved for modern branding, clean wordmarks, simplified graphical icons, or geometric shapes, are actually in some ways easier to digitize than traditional heraldic crests. But they still require expert handling to look professional on uniform fabric.

Modern school logos often use Pantone-matched brand colors that need to be reproduced accurately in thread. Thread color matching isn't exact because thread has physical texture and sheen that affect how colors read visually. A digitizer with experience in school logo work knows how to select thread colors that match the visual intent of the brand even when a perfect thread match doesn't exist.

Logo digitizing also involves decisions about which elements stitch first and how each color stop is handled. Poor color sequencing means the embroidery machine stops and restarts more often than necessary, slowing production and increasing the risk of registration errors between colors. Good sequencing keeps the machine running efficiently and keeps the design in perfect registration throughout.

Applique Embroidery Digitizing for School Designs

Applique embroidery digitizing offers a specific advantage for school crests that cover large areas or use bold color blocking. Instead of stitching a solid fill area with thousands of thread stitches, applique uses a fabric piece laid down and secured with stitching, reducing stitch count, production time, and thread cost while often looking more vibrant and dimensional than a pure embroidery fill.

School crests with large shield backgrounds, big color-blocked sections, or wide banner areas are excellent candidates for applique. The applique fabric is cut to shape and tacked down by the first stitch pass, then additional stitching adds detail, outlines, and text on top of the fabric layer. The result is a layered, textured crest that catches light differently than flat stitching and often looks more premium.

Applique digitizing is more technically involved than standard digitizing because it requires precise tack-down stitches, machine stop commands for fabric placement, border stitches that secure edges cleanly, and detail passes that register correctly against the applique fabric. 3D Puff Digitizing for School Sports Uniforms

3D puff digitizing creates raised, three-dimensional embroidery by stitching over a foam layer. It's become popular on school sports caps, team hats, and athletic kits because the elevated design creates a bold, high-visibility look that really stands out on the field.

For school sports programs, 3D puff embroidery on caps and beanies gives team identity gear a premium, professional appearance that flat embroidery can't match. A school mascot, team initial, or sports logo stitched in 3D puff on a structured cap looks genuinely impressive and holds up well through the kind of active use sports uniforms experience.

The digitizing requirements for 3D puff work are specific. The stitch density needs to be higher on the edges to cleanly cover the foam while keeping the top surface smooth and even. The foam height has to be specified so the digitizer can calibrate the stitch length and angle correctly. And the design can't have thin elements or fine detail because the foam layer prevents precise control of narrow stitch areas.

Embroidery Digitizing on School Polo Shirts

Embroidery digitizing on school polo shirts handles differently from blazer crest work because polo pique fabric, the textured knit used in most school polo shirts, has its own specific challenges. The bumpy texture of pique can cause stitch registration issues and make fine detail look fuzzy if the digitizing doesn't account for it properly.

The key adjustment for polo shirt embroidery is density and underlay. Pique fabric has more give than woven blazer material, and it stretches slightly under the presser foot during stitching. If the density is set too low, the fabric texture shows through between stitches. If the underlay isn't built correctly, the design shifts as the pique stretches, causing elements to misalign.

For school polo crests, which are typically smaller than blazer crests, usually 2 to 3 inches wide on the left chest, the design also needs to be optimized for the reduced size. Elements that work at 4 inches often need to be simplified or consolidated at 2.5 inches. Very small text, thin heraldic lines, and fine decorative elements may need to be thickened or removed to stitch cleanly at polo crest scale.

Professional Digitizing for Embroidered School Patches

Professional digitizing for embroidered school patches is a slightly different workflow from garment embroidery because patches are stitched on a separate fabric substrate and then applied to the uniform, rather than being stitched directly onto the garment.

Custom embroidered patches are popular for school badges, house badges, achievement patches, and prefect or captain insignia. They're sewn on by hand or heat-applied after the school uniform is otherwise finished, which makes them flexible and easy to add as students earn different designations. Our embroidery digitizing service handles patch digitizing with the specific border and density settings that patch production requires.

Patch digitizing differs from direct garment digitizing in a few important ways. Patches use a Merrow border or satin stitch border around the edge that needs to be built into the file. The base fabric of the patch is often twill or felt, which accepts dense stitching well. And the overall design can often include more detail than direct garment embroidery because the patch substrate doesn't stretch or move during stitching.

For school house badges, where different color patches identify different student groups, having separate digitized files for each color variation is the most efficient approach. The design structure stays identical, but the color assignments change. Digitizing Services Embroidery: Pricing for Schools

Digitizing services embroidery pricing for school uniform work typically falls into a predictable range once you understand what factors drive the cost. A school crest or logo isn't priced the same as a simple text design, but the investment is one-time and pays for itself across every production run.

Simple text-based school name digitizing typically runs $10 to $15. This covers a clean wordmark or school name in an embroidery-safe font at a standard size. It's the most affordable entry point for school uniform digitizing.

Standard school crests with moderate complexity, a shield shape with two or three internal elements, a motto text banner, and the school name, typically cost $25 to $45. These designs take a skilled digitizer 30 to 60 minutes to complete properly, and the pricing reflects that skilled labor.

Complex traditional coats of arms with multiple heraldic elements, fine detail work, small motto text, and six or more thread colors can run $45 to $75 for digitizing. These are the most demanding school crest projects and they require the most time and expertise to complete at professional quality.

Embroidery Digitizing Service: Quality and Durability

An embroidery digitizing service that delivers quality files for school uniforms is really delivering durability, not just aesthetics. School uniforms get washed far more frequently than most embroidered garments. A school crest that looks great after digitizing but starts to unravel, fray, or distort after 20 washes has failed its actual purpose.

Durability in embroidery starts with digitizing decisions. The right underlay pattern stabilizes the design and prevents top stitches from shifting through repeated washing and wearing. Correct tie-ins and tie-offs at the start and end of every thread run prevent unraveling. Proper density settings mean the design is neither so sparse that it wears away quickly nor so dense that it stresses the fabric and causes tearing.

Thread choice also affects durability, but that's usually the embroiderer's decision rather than the digitizer's. What the digitizer controls is how many times each needle penetrates the fabric and at what angles, which affects both how the thread is secured and how much stress the fabric absorbs. A well-digitized file minimizes unnecessary needle penetrations while still producing the correct visual density.

DMC threads, Madeira, and Isacord are all popular thread brands for school uniform work because they offer good colorfastness and tensile strength. The best digitizing in the world combined with poor-quality thread will still give you a uniform that fades and breaks down quickly.

Embroidery Digitize: Process from Artwork to Production

Embroidery digitize workflow for school uniforms follows a specific process that starts with your school's approved artwork and ends with a production-ready stitch file. Understanding this process helps you prepare your submissions correctly and get better results faster.

Step one is artwork preparation. The best starting point is a vector file, AI, EPS, or PDF, of the school crest with Pantone colors specified and all elements on separate layers. If only a raster file exists, the highest possible resolution version is needed, ideally 300 DPI or better. Many schools have vector artwork from their original crest design process, but older institutions may only have scanned or low-res versions that need cleanup first.

If your artwork needs to be converted to vector before digitizing, Digitizing Studio offers vector tracing services that clean up and vectorize raster school crests before the digitizing process begins. It's a useful first step for schools whose artwork is only available as old scans or low-resolution JPEGs.

Step two is specifying the job requirements. This means communicating the finished size of the crest, which garment type and fabric it'll be stitched on, the placement position, the thread brand and color numbers if you have them, and the embroidery machine format you need.

Step three is the actual digitizing. An expert digitizer opens your artwork in professional embroidery software such as Wilcom Embroidery Studio or Hatch Embroidery and manually builds the stitch file element by element. Each decision is made with the specific fabric, size, and machine in mind.

Step four is quality check and delivery. The file is reviewed for stitch count, sequence logic, tie-ins, and simulation accuracy before delivery. You receive the file plus a stitch simulation preview so you can see the expected result before running it on a machine.

Can the same digitized file work on blazers and polo shirts?

Not ideally. Blazers use heavy woven fabric and polo shirts use knit pique. Each behaves differently under the needle. For best results, have a dedicated file optimized for each fabric type. Digitizing Studio can produce both versions from your single artwork file.

What artwork format do I need for school crest digitizing?

Vector files, AI, EPS, or PDF, are ideal because they're scalable without quality loss. High-resolution raster files at 300 DPI or above also work. If your school only has a low-resolution scan of the crest, Digitizing Studio offers vector tracing to clean it up first.
